Radhapur

Radhapur is a village located in Bhagawanpur Ii sub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Mugberia are the district & sub-district headquarters of Radhapur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Radhapur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Radhap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Radhapur is 345255. The village spans a total geographical area of 322.64 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721626. Contai is nearest town to Radhap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Radhapur

According to the 2011 Census, Radhapur has a total population of about 3,670, with approximately 1,894 males and 1,776 females. The sex ratio is around 937 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 429 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 71 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 81.20%, with male literacy at about 83.21% and female literacy near 79.05%. There are around 848 households in the village. Connectivity of Radhap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Radhapur. As per the 2011 stats, Radhap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
